What is a 97 Camry Stereo Wiring Diagram and How is it Used?

A 97 Camry stereo wiring diagram is essentially a blueprint for your car's audio system. It's a visual representation that shows how all the components – from the head unit (your stereo) to the speakers, power source, and any other accessories – are connected. Think of it like a map for electricity flowing through your car to bring your music to life. Without this diagram, connecting a new stereo or diagnosing a problem can feel like navigating a maze blindfolded. The importance of having the correct 97 Camry stereo wiring diagram cannot be overstated; it ensures proper functionality and prevents damage to your car's electrical system or the new stereo components.

These diagrams are crucial for several reasons. Firstly, they identify the purpose of each wire by color code and position. This allows you to know which wire provides constant power, which is switched with the ignition, which carries the audio signal to the speakers, and which controls things like antenna retraction or dimmer functions. When installing an aftermarket stereo, for instance, you'll need to match the wires from your new unit to the corresponding wires in the Camry's harness. Beyond installation, a 97 Camry stereo wiring diagram is invaluable for troubleshooting. If your speakers suddenly stop working, or your stereo won't turn on, the diagram helps you trace the connections and pinpoint the break or fault in the circuit. Below are common uses:

  • Aftermarket stereo installation
  • Speaker replacement
  • Troubleshooting no-power issues
  • Diagnosing sound quality problems
  • Adding amplifiers or subwoofers

To make this process even clearer, many diagrams use standardized symbols and color codes. While variations can exist between specific trim levels or optional sound systems, the core principles remain the same. Here's a simplified look at what you might encounter:

Wire Color Typical Function
Yellow Constant 12V Power
Red Accessory (Ignition Switched) Power
Blue Power Antenna / Amplifier Turn-On
Black Ground
Orange Illumination / Dimmer

Understanding these common color codes is a fantastic starting point, but always refer to your specific 97 Camry stereo wiring diagram for absolute accuracy. You might also find numbered pinouts on the stereo connector that correspond to specific functions, offering another layer of identification.
